Language eng - English Country ES - Spain Keywords RGTA ; alkali injury ; corneal healing Subject RIV FF - HEENT, Dentistry R&D Projects GAP304/11/0653 GA ČR - Czech Science Foundation (CSF) Institutional support UEM-P - RVO:68378041 CEZ AV0Z50390512 - UEM-P (2005-2011) UT WOS 000333756800006 EID SCOPUS 84897046223 Annotation Heparan sulfate mimicking regeneration agent (RGTA) enabled the healing of the rabbit cornea, injured with highly concentrated alkali. When RGTA was applied by dropping on the damaged cornea early after the injury, it highly suppresed the development of corneal ulcerative processes. When the damaged cornea was topically treated with RGTA later after the injury – during the occurence of corneal ulcers, it healed majority of them. The healing of the alkali-injured cornea by RGTA took place due to the reduction of proteolytic, oxidative and nitrosative damage. key words (3): RGTA, alkali injury, corneal healing Workplace Institute of Experimental Medicine Contact Lenka Koželská, lenka.kozelska@iem.cas.cz, Tel.: 241 062 218, 296 442 218 Year of Publishing 2015
